【js手机号码正则表达式】js验证手机号码的实例代码

时间:2021-05-26  来源:正则表达式  阅读:

闲来没事,写了一个小例子,欢迎大家多提宝贵建议~~~

下面讲一下手机号码的特征:以1开头,第二位是3,5,7,8,9中的一位,从第三位开始是任意数字,一共有11位

 

 代码如下

 

 

 手机号码验证

 

 

 Tel:

 

 <scripttype="text/javascript">

 //当tel失去焦点的时候,验证是否是正确的手机号码,如果不是,在tel_tip中提示错误

 window.onload=function(){

  var oTel = document.getElementById("tel");

  oTel.onblur = function(){

  var isTel = isTelephone(oTel.value);

  var oSpan = document.getElementById("tel_tip");

  if(!isTel){

   oSpan.style.color = "red";

   oSpan.innerHTML = "错误的手机号码,请重新输入";

  }else{

   oSpan.style.color = "green";

   oSpan.innerHTML = "正确的手机号码";

  }

  }

 }

 function isTelephone(tel){

  var p = /^1[35789][0-9]{9}$/;

  return p.test(tel);

 }

 </script>

 

 

【js手机号码正则表达式】js验证手机号码的实例代码

http://m.bbyears.com/aspjiaocheng/119982.html

推荐访问:
相关阅读 猜你喜欢
本类排行 本类最新